Interview with Vittoria Rezzonico, Computational Sciences and Engineering Coordinator at EPFL
Vittoria Rezzonico is the new Computational Sciences and Engineering Coordinator at EPFL. In this function Vittoria has become the reference person at EPFL for HPC issues and she is coordinating the deployment of shared HPC systems at the university.
